HR 2105 · 93th Congress · Public Lands and Natural Resources
A bill to provide that no State development agency shall be entitled to receive Federal financial assistance in any form unless it provides satisfactory assurances that it will take no action inconsistent with local zoning laws.

Provides that no State development agency shall be entitled to receive Federal financial assistance in any form unless it provides satisfactory assurances that it will take no action inconsistent with local zoning laws. Authorizes the Secretary of Housing and Urban Development to prescribe such regulations and impose such conditions as may be necessary to guarantee that State development agencies receiving Federal financial assistance will comply with the requirements of this Act.…
